Details for Earth Mass (Planetary Science)

Introduction : The Earth mass is astronomy's standard unit for terrestrial planets and exoplanets, equal to our planet's mass (5.972 × 10²⁴ kg). This massive measurement provides meaningful scale for planetary bodies from super-Earths to gas giants.

History & Origin : First estimated through gravitational measurements in the 18th century. Precision improved with satellite geodesy. Now serves as the reference mass for rocky planet classification.

Current Use : Standard measurement for exoplanets (0.1-10 M⊕ for terrestrial planets). Used in planetary science for interior modeling and gravitational calculations. Common in comparative planetology studies.

Details for Kilogram-Force Second²/Meter (Obsolete Unit)

Introduction : This obsolete unit represents mass through gravitational force, defined as the mass requiring 1 kgf to accelerate at 1 m/s². It served as an early attempt to reconcile force and mass units before SI standardization.

History & Origin : Used in early 20th century engineering systems before full SI adoption. Phased out as the kilogram became the unambiguous base unit of mass in the International System of Units.

Current Use : Primarily of historical interest today. May appear in very old engineering specifications or physics textbooks predating modern SI conventions.
